Three men have been have been charged after cannabis with a suspected value of more than 10 million euro was seized in the Co Louth area.
A joint operation by Irish Revenue Customs Service and the Garda National Drugs and Organised Crime Bureau seized 506kg of cannabis in a raid on a property on Friday.
The estimated value of the drugs is 10.12 million euro.
Two men in their 30s and one in his 50s are to appear before a special sitting of Dundalk District Court on Saturday evening.
